at 9 months your baby is probably at a huge development and growth phase, and is also moving around a lot. it is possible that your baby gets really tired, and is extra hungry too. try bringing down meal time to just a little before bedtime, so that your baby is happily full. also, make sure that your baby sleeps on time and is not over-exerted by the time he finally falls asleep. massage his legs and hands each day, as well as his back and shoulders. give him a nice warm bath before bed to calm him down. if he still wakes up in the middle of the night, try and calm him down to sleep, instead of getting up and playing or talking too much.
